SUNDAY II OF THE TIME OF LENT (Mt 17:1-9)

In spite of the intense experience lived by the disciples who accompanied Jesus on Mount Tabor, he warned them not to tell what had happened until the Resurrection. Because the path he is going to propose to his followers is not a path of glory and honour, but another, difficult one, in which the love of God and neighbour without limits, forgiveness, humility and service prevail. However, the Resurrection confirms the validity of that message. And the experience of the transfiguration is a preview of it. In our families, called to be bearers of the Resurrection but also subject to the harshness of the journey, we need moments of “Tabor” so as not to lose our horizon and to gain the strength to continue being disciples who always seek to do good.

PROPOSAL TO CARE FOR THE FAMILY this week.
Lent is a good occasion to reinforce in the family the option to continue doing good (“regardless of who”, as the saying goes in English). And to gather strength for this mission, this week we propose to carry out some activities together that will fill you, that will encourage you… like the transfiguration.
